I'm using it on Windows 7 Ultimate, and the annoying thing is: when my Firefox browser windows are Maximized, and I press Ctrl+F to "Find/Search" for a pattern on a web-page, the Find/Search toolbar is now hidden by my Windows task-bar across the bottom of the screen. The only workaround I have for this is to set my Windows task-bar to "auto-hide", but I don't like doing that.

This wasn't a problem in Firefox 3.x. Please issue a fix for this asap, or let me know how to change my settings so the Find/Search toolbar shows up just above my Windows task-bar just like it used to.

Install this add-on: Status 4-Evar It replaces the status bar at the foot of the browser which Mozilla removed in FF4 for some strange reason.
